Output 26086ae08684c71a185ee391a1d8083d445b987603ce2b5f5a7097710bba6662:0

value
12842557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d164239f606ae4b217015fc9b8be25bf5e33b1a9 OP_EQUAL
address
MSzKRK6tJHRubwCFYX6R17Uf4pzVwffmA9
transaction
26086ae08684c71a185ee391a1d8083d445b987603ce2b5f5a7097710bba6662
spent
true